Как перенести архив с моего веб-сервера (например, http://example.com/backup.tar.gz) в корзину Amazon S3? Должен ли я загрузить его локально и загрузить?
3 ответа
3
Если у вас есть SSH-доступ к вашему серверу и вы можете использовать инструменты amazon (например, пакет ec2-api-tools
в Ubuntu), то вы можете загрузить свой tarball прямо с вашего сервера. Однако, если у вас есть только FTP-доступ к нему, ваш единственный выбор (afaik) - загрузить его и загрузить с рабочей станции.
1
Вы можете использовать эти услуги
или же
http://www.cloudberrylab.com/amazon-s3-windows-server-backup.aspx
0
Вы можете использовать Minio Client или MC. Используя [mc cp] вы можете достичь этого и, альтернативно, написать работу cron для того же.
$ mc cp backup.tar.gz S3/Mybackupbucket
mc: minio client
cp : copy command
backup.tar.gz: File to be copied on S3 bucket
S3: Alias for https://s3.amazonaws.com
Mybackupbucket: your remote bucket on S3
Надеюсь, поможет.